Coach Harbaugh's new Twitter page is racking up the followers
As of 10:45 p.m. Friday his Twitter page, created in the afternoon, had 91,100 followers. He is already one of the 10 most-followed coaches in the NCAA. The only coaches ahead of him:
170K Urban Meyer
159K Butch Jones
153K Les Miles
149K Mark Richt
121K Brian Kelly
107K Bret Bielema
107K Gus Malzahn
96.2K Bo Pelini
94.1K James Franklin
It's only a matter of time before IT HAPPENS and Jim takes over the top spot, I'm sure.
